I use this and for lay people it gets great responses. Do not underestimate the simplicity of this method. I use this with a shogun wallet where you show the wallet empty then when you are ready you can show the DB in the other side of the wallet. So a card has appeared in the wallet then you remove the card and do the DL and show them their card ended up in the wallet. Easy and effective

I created a trick with a 3 card selection. I said the cards will jump from the deck to my outer jacket (or shirt) pocket. I gestured. Then will fly out of my pocket... Which they just did, landing FACE DOWN (hahah) on the floor. Picked 'em up placed on top of deck and turned 'em over... you know the rest... 3 DB'S of course.
